2 C4H10 + 13 O2 + 8 CO2 + 10 H2O Molecules

Chemistry
1 answer:
Alik [6]4 years ago
6 0

Answer:

This reaction is combustion reaction

Explanation:

2 C4H10 + 13 O2 -----> 8 CO2 + 10 H2O

This reaction is combustion reaction which includes butane reaction with oxygen forming the carbon dioxide and water.

This is balanced stoichiometry reaction.

What is a redox reaction?
grin007 [14]
When an atom or molecule loses an electron it is oxidized and the reaction is called oxidation, when an atom or molecule gains an electron it is reduced and this is known as reduction. Both oxidation and reduction are known as Redox reaction

at atmoshperic pressure, a balloon contains 2.00L of nitrogen of gas. How would the volume change if the Kelvin temperature were
Nataly [62]

<u>Answer:</u> The percent change in volume will be 25 %

<u>Explanation:</u>

To calculate the final temperature of the system, we use the equation given by Charles' Law. This law states that volume of the gas is directly proportional to the temperature of the gas at constant pressure.

Mathematically,

\frac{V_1}{T_1}=\frac{V_2}{T_2}

where,

V_1\text{ and }T_1 are the initial volume and temperature of the gas.

V_2\text{ and }T_2 are the final volume and temperature of the gas.

We are given:

V_1=2L\\T_1=T_1\\V_2=?\\T_2=75\% \text{ of }T_1=0.75\times T_1

Putting values in above equation, we get:

\frac{2L}{T_1}=\frac{V_2}{0.75\times T_1}\\\\V_2=\frac{2\times 0.75\times T_1}{T_1}=1.5L

Percent change of volume = \frac{\text{Change in volume}}{\text{Initial volume}}\times 100

Percent change of volume = \frac{(2-1.5)}{2}\times 100=25\%

Hence, the percent change in volume will be 25 %
